Forecasting expert Philip Tetlock has suggested an improved approach to predicting the future development and impact of artificial intelligence (AI). Known for his research on expert judgment and forecasting accuracy, Tetlock argues that traditional methods may fall short in estimating AI’s trajectory. Instead, he emphasizes the importance of adopting more nuanced, probabilistic thinking and considering a wider range of scenarios to better capture the uncertainties involved.
Tetlock’s insights come amid growing interest and concern surrounding AI advancements, particularly related to safety, ethics, and societal implications. He advocates for integrating diverse perspectives and improving the methodologies used to forecast technological progress, to better inform policymakers and stakeholders. His approach underscores the complex and unpredictable nature of AI development, suggesting that flexible frameworks and ongoing reassessment are crucial.
The researcher’s comments highlight a broader push within the forecasting community to refine tools and techniques for anticipating future trends in rapidly evolving fields. As AI continues to advance, experts hope that more sophisticated prediction models can help anticipate challenges and opportunities more effectively, guiding responsible development and regulation. Tetlock’s ideas contribute to ongoing discussions about how society can better prepare for the uncertain future shaped by AI innovations.
